Death Anniversary: Remembering Mama Lucy Kibaki

I never bothered to study the history of Kenya’s second First Lady until I sat down to do this story. An interesting fact I soon found out is that we share the same birth month and day. This iron lady was born Lucy Muthoni Kagai on January 13 in 1936 in Mukurwe-ini, Nyeri County.

She was born of Rose Nyachomba and father John Kagai who was a pastor of the Presbyterian Church of East Africa in Nyeri’s Muhito Parish. Ostensibly a bright student, Mama Lucy studied at Alliance Girls High School from where she would embark to a teaching career.
